[arch-commits] Commit in pymsnt/trunk (PKGBUILD pymsn.rc)
Sergej Pupykin
spupykin at nymeria.archlinux.org
Mon May 13 14:35:40 UTC 2013
Date: Monday, May 13, 2013 @ 16:35:39
Author: spupykin
Revision: 90712
upgpkg: pymsnt 0.11.3-9
upd
Modified:
pymsnt/trunk/PKGBUILD
Deleted:
pymsnt/trunk/pymsn.rc
----------+
PKGBUILD | 5 +----
pymsn.rc | 53 -----------------------------------------------------
2 files changed, 1 insertion(+), 57 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2013-05-13 14:35:35 UTC (rev 90711)
+++ PKGBUILD 2013-05-13 14:35:39 UTC (rev 90712)
@@ -4,7 +4,7 @@
pkgname=pymsnt
pkgver=0.11.3
-pkgrel=8
+pkgrel=9
pkgdesc="jabber msn transport"
arch=(any)
url="http://delx.net.au/projects/pymsnt/"
@@ -12,12 +12,10 @@
backup=(etc/ejabberd/pymsn.xml)
depends=('python2' 'twisted' 'python2-pyopenssl')
source=(http://delx.net.au/projects/pymsnt/tarballs/pymsnt-$pkgver.tar.gz
- pymsn.rc
pymsnt.service
config.xml
pymsnt-version.patch)
md5sums=('e74049fb1bfae59846b1be3d4ef80299'
- '40627f2cb05618771728d29d7c3a6999'
'ecf20ab8360211436f7c9d149b6a3420'
'4c07c88403515f1da61974b57acf8db7'
'50c03d89ca1f682ebffcfacb70d1ba00')
@@ -39,7 +37,6 @@
install -D -m0644 ./config.xml $pkgdir/etc/ejabberd/pymsn.xml
mv $pkgdir/usr/lib/$pkgname/config-example.xml $pkgdir/etc/ejabberd/pymsn_example.xml
ln -s ../../../etc/ejabberd/pymsn.xml $pkgdir/usr/lib/$pkgname/config.xml
- install -D -m0755 pymsn.rc $pkgdir/etc/rc.d/pymsnt
install -Dm0644 $srcdir/$pkgname.service $pkgdir/usr/lib/systemd/system/$pkgname.service
}
Deleted: pymsn.rc
===================================================================
--- pymsn.rc 2013-05-13 14:35:35 UTC (rev 90711)
+++ pymsn.rc 2013-05-13 14:35:39 UTC (rev 90712)
@@ -1,53 +0,0 @@
-#!/bin/bash
-
-. /etc/rc.conf
-. /etc/rc.d/functions
-
-get_pid() {
- [ -f /var/run/pymsnt.pid ] && echo `cat /var/run/pymsnt.pid`
-}
-
-case "$1" in
- start)
- stat_busy "Starting jabber MSN transport daemon"
-
- [ -f /var/run/pymsnt.pid ] && rm -f /var/run/pymsnt.pid
- PID=`get_pid`
- if [ -z "$PID" ]; then
- cd /usr/lib/pymsnt && exec python2 ./PyMSNt.py 1>/dev/null 2>/dev/null &
- if [ $? -gt 0 ]; then
- stat_fail
- exit 1
- else
- add_daemon pymsnt
- stat_done
- fi
- else
- stat_fail
- exit 1
- fi
- ;;
-
- stop)
- stat_busy "Stopping jabber MSN transport daemon"
- PID=`get_pid`
- [ ! -z "$PID" ] && kill $PID &> /dev/null
- if [ $? -gt 0 ]; then
- stat_fail
- exit 1
- else
- rm -f /var/run/pymsnt.pid &> /dev/null
- rm_daemon pymsnt
- stat_done
- fi
- ;;
-
- restart)
- $0 stop
- sleep 3
- $0 start
- ;;
- *)
- echo "usage: $0 {start|stop|restart}"
-esac
-exit 0
More information about the arch-commits
mailing list